Sylna is a medium-sized female tortoiseshell kitten with a short coat, currently being cared for at For Belle's Sake Rescue & Rehabilitation. She has special needs due to rear paralysis, but she does not let this diminish her vibrant spirit. Sylna is not yet house trained, though she manages her potty needs independently. She is spayed and her vaccinations are up to date. Her playful and affectionate personality shines through, offering a wonderful companion to those ready to cherish her.

Questions about Sylna

  • What type of living environment is this breed usually best suited for?

    Tortoiseshell cats, like most domestic cats, are adaptable and thrive in most indoor homes. They appreciate a secure, enriched environment where they can explore and relax.

  • How much outdoor space does this breed typically need?

    Tortoiseshell cats do not require access to outdoor space if they are provided with plenty of enrichment and playtime indoors. Many thrive happily as indoor-only pets.

  • Is this breed typically suitable for homes with children?

    Most domestic cats, including tortoiseshells, can be great with respectful children, especially if socialized from a young age. Always supervise young children to ensure positive interactions.
